When someone makes you feel comfortable and at home, that person is being hospitable, providing a warm, friendly environment. Anything hospitable is welcoming and open. A Greek proverb suggested that in being hospitable, the main feeling should be good will.

What do you call a person who is hospitable?

British English: hospitable ADJECTIVE /hɒˈspɪtəbəl; ˈhɒspɪtəbl/ A hospitable person is friendly, generous, and welcoming to guests or people they have just met. The locals are hospitable and welcoming.

What is the meaning of hospitable in English?

English Language Learners Definition of hospitable. : generous and friendly to guests or visitors. : having an environment where plants, animals, or people can live or grow easily. : ready or willing to accept or consider something.

What is the difference between receptive and hospitable?

hospitable – having an open mind; “hospitable to new ideas”; “open to suggestions”. receptive, open – ready or willing to receive favorably; “receptive to the proposals”.
